Scramble with flocks
Chicken flocks: a metaphor for mediocre people. It used to mean people fighting for fame and fortune. [source] Chu Quyuan's Buju in the Warring States Period: "would you rather compete with Huang Hu? Will you compete with the chickens for food? "
